What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Product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Product Manager, you need strong analytical abilities, market research skills, and experience in product lifecycle management, often backed by a relevant degree or equivalent work experience. Familiarity with tools like Jira, Asana, and analytics platforms, as well as certifications such as Certified Scrum Product Owner (CSPO), are commonly required. Exceptional communication, stakeholder management, and problem-solving skills set successful Product Managers apart. These competencies are vital for effectively guiding product development, aligning teams, and delivering solutions that meet market needs.

How do Product Managers typ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during the product development process?

Product Managers play a central role in coordinating with cross-functional teams, including engineering, design, marketing, and sales. They facilitate regular meetings, clarify product goals, and ensure all stakeholders are aligned on priorities and timelines. It’s common for Product Managers to act as the bridge between technical and non-technical teams, translating customer needs into actionable tasks and managing feedback loops. This collaborative approach helps deliver products that satisfy both user expectations and business objectives.

What are Product Managers?

Product Managers are professionals responsible for guiding the development, launch, and ongoing improvement of products within a company. They act as the link between cross-functional teams such as engineering, design, marketing, and sales to ensure the product meets customer needs and aligns with business goals. Product Managers define the product vision, gather and prioritize requirements, and oversee the product lifecycle from concept to launch. Their role is crucial in delivering successful products that create value for both the business and its customers.

What is the difference between Product Manager vs Product Owner?

AspectProduct ManagerProduct Owner
Primary FocusStrategic planning, market research, and long-term product visionManaging the product backlog and ensuring development aligns with the product vision
ResponsibilitiesDefining product strategy, stakeholder communication, and roadmap developmentPrioritizing features, writing user stories, and working closely with development teams
Work EnvironmentCross-functional teams, executive stakeholders, market analysisAgile teams, Scrum ceremonies, close collaboration with developers
Common UsageUsed in tech companies, startups, and large enterprises for strategic product rolesCommon in Agile/Scrum environments, especially in software development projects

While both roles focus on product success, the Product Manager handles the overall strategy and market positioning, whereas the Product Owner concentrates on executing the product backlog and working directly with development teams to deliver features.

What you'll do

As the Product Manager for Healthcare & Life Sciences (HLS) you will focus on delivering solutions that allow our customers to better support end patients, clinicians, administrators, payers, and life sciences stakeholders. You will work with cross-functional leaders to define a multi-year strategy and lead the efforts to build the roadmap, vision, and priorities for supporting this priority industry. You will deeply understand how Docusign can best deliver for our HLS customer needs and work with product development teams across Docusign to deliver product capabilities and solutions that support Healthcare & Life Sciences customers end-to-end agreement flows within provider, payer, pharma, and emerging digital health segments. Interacting directly with customers to validate solutions and market needs will be a key part of your role. Docusign has built award winning and the most pervasive technology for enabling businesses to automate their agreement processes - from generating agreements, negotiating between parties, getting agreements electronically signed, managing the workflows and integrations once an agreement is signed and analyzing and deriving insights from agreements. Today, Docusign's products meet the needs of customers extending from individual consumers to large Enterprises. You will serve as the subject matter expert guiding product development teams on what capabilities and solutions will best meet HLS customers' biggest agreement challenges related to patient intake, physician onboarding, pharmaceutical development, and more. Using qualitative and quantitative insights, you will deliver a strategy and product roadmap that both transforms how Docusign meets HLS customer needs and drives measurable impact. In this position you will work cross-functionally with Design, Marketing, and Engineering and engage directly with customers to experiment and iterate.

This position is an individual contributor role reporting to the Vice President of Product Management.

Responsibility

  • Lead the strategy and roadmap for delivering product capabilities and solutions for Healthcare & Life Sciences (HLS)

  • Build products aligned with HIPAA, FDA and other frameworks incl. FHIR, HL7 (as applicable)

  • Facilitate customer engagements to validate solutions and market needs within Healthcare & Life Sciences

  • Drive the vision and requirements, translate them to functional specifications to facilitate a sound design and deliver a delightful customer experience in partnership with product development teams across Docusign

  • Leverage primary and secondary research in to deepen understanding of HLS customers across their lifecycle, from awareness to renewal and expansion

  • Own insights on the market including staying abreast of Healthcare & Life Sciences industry trends, events, and channels to anticipate customer needs

  • Understand key personas, pain points and jobs to be done within Healthcare & Life Sciences by closely working with customers, User Research, and Marketing

  • Understand and profile high value, innovative use cases purchased and implemented by key HLS customers

  • Work closely with the Business Development team to identify partners critical to scaling Healthcare & Life Sciences offerings

  • Monitor, measure, and report on key business and customer metrics in collaboration with Data Science and identify areas for continuous testing, experimentation and evolution

  • Evaluate and prioritize product roadmap and backlogs in alignment with product development teams for effective release and sprint planning

  • Facilitate requirements definition across teams to create developer-ready epics, user stories and acceptance criteria while identifying dependencies and relative priority with other product managers

  • Partner with Program Management, Design and Engineering to ensure product ships on time and to quality

  • Collaborate with Marketing, Pricing, Sales, Support, Legal, Security and other cross-functional teams on successful go-to-market and product adoption
